George Anson Byron 1758–1793 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 30 NOV 1758

Birth Location: Plymouth, Devon, England

Death Date: 11 JUN 1793

Death Location: Dawlish, Devon, England

Father: John, Byron

Mother: Sophia Trevanion

Spouse(s): Charlotte Dallas

Children(s): George Byron

George Anson Byron was born in 1758 in Plymouth, Devon, England, the child of John Foulweather Jack Byron And Sophia Trevanion. George Anson Byron married Charlotte Henrietta Dallas, and had children including George Anson Of Rochdale 7Th Baron Byron. George Anson Byron passed away in 1793 in Dawlish, Devon, England.
